The Pirates and the Reds are going to kick off opening day in Cincinnati. What is going to be interesting for the Pirates is to see how the lineup is going to hold steady as they are coming into the game with some questions as to how lingering injuries are going to impact the team. One of the main offensive threats for the Pirates could find himself doing minor league rehab to start the year off as Gregory Polanco is still recovering from his shoulder surgery.

The pitcher the Pirates are planning on sending out to the mound in this game is Jameson Taillon. Taillon is a 4 year veteran and is making his first opening day start here. During his career Taillon has managed to pick up a 21-21 record, struck out 389 batters, and has posted a 3.63 ERA on his career so far.

The Reds injury bug is already coming back this year. The part that cost the Reds so much last season, outside of horrible pitching, is coming back strong as Scooter Gennett has already been told he will miss 8 to 12 weeks with a strained right groin. What else is going to hurt the Reds out in this game is the depth is not present on the roster that they would have liked to have had and that is after some big name signings in the off season.

The Reds are planning on sending out Luis Castillo to the mound in this game here. What is surprising is Castillo was not expecting to get the opening day nod and that could lead to him having quite a few jitters in the game. Castillo has managed to post a 13-19 record on his young career, but he has struck out 263 batters in his career, and has posted a 3.89 ERA.
